NASA Uses Machine Learning to Enhance Flash Flood Warnings
Summary
NASA describes TACLS, a machine learning system that helps meteorologists detect flash flood risk faster. The software analyzes GNSS satellite data, flags unusual atmospheric moisture patterns, and presents likely flood areas in a visualization tool for human review. NASA, UC San Diego, and NOAA’s National Weather Service collaborated on the system, and forecasters are already working to incorporate it into Southern California operations. The project is open source, which could let other researchers adapt the model or build similar tools from scratch.
